## Scanwright 4.2 — Changed defaults

Breaking for plugin authors. Barcode scanner integration now defaults to continuous-scan mode; single-shot must be requested explicitly. Symbology auto-detect is on by default, and the legacy beep callback is removed. Plugins targeting 4.1 behavior must pin the compatibility flag before init. New defaults ship as listed in the configuration below.

config for fajof-badug:
holael:
  log_level: error
  metrics_host: metrics.holael.tolvaqsys.internal
  pool_size: 32

Handover: driver-assignment heuristic (Fleetwise dispatch). The heuristic scores drivers by proximity, shift remaining, and vehicle class, then breaks ties with last-assignment recency. Weights live in the dispatch-config repo; changing them requires a replay test against the Norvale depot dataset. Known quirk: scores go stale if the location feed lags more than 90 seconds. For new team members: direct all weight-change requests to the owner listed below.

named custodian: Brivan Eliath Quenox Frador

## Further Reading

The Gatewren validator plugin system loads checks at startup from a manifest, so reviewers should pay attention to anything that registers validators dynamically — that path skips the usual schema pinning. Plugins get a sandboxed context with no filesystem access, and each validator must declare the fields it reads. If a PR touches the loader or the manifest parser, flag it for an extra pair of eyes. Architecture notes, plugin author guidelines, and the review checklist all live on the internal page.

runbook for hawif-tajeg: https://grafana.plorvasoft.example/dash